This impressive traditional home is being sold for the first time, having remained in the same family since it was built in 1952. Over the years the house has been thoughtfully extended to provide an extensive footprint of accommodation including a completely self-contained annexe with a separate entrance, a hallway, a kitchen, a shower room and bedroom/living space.

The interior is well-appointed and tastefully decorated throughout, with the main house offering two living rooms, a spacious open-plan family kitchen, and four good-sized bedrooms, with the master having an ensuite bathroom.

Outside, there is plenty of parking, an integral garage and at the rear a delightful mature west-facing garden.

68 Areley Common is accessed from the private road via a two-car driveway, which leads to the integral single garage. The garage has mahogany double doors to the front and benefits from power, lighting and a door providing access from the kitchen. The property also has two additional parking spaces situated opposite the driveway on the private road. Also to the front of the property is a nice garden area with a lawn, sunken wildlife pond and borders.


Entrance
The property is accessed via a canopy porch leading to a spacious and welcoming hallway, which is tastefully appointed and has space for a settee. From here stairs rise to the first floor with storage underneath and doors radiate to the ground floor living rooms and kitchen.


Sitting room
To the front of the property is a lovely bay-fronted sitting room with parquet flooring, a picture rail and a feature fireplace. An internal door from this room leads to the annexe, which also has a separate entrance from the outside.


Living room
At the rear of the property, there is a wonderful living room enjoying a sunny west-facing outlook, with patio doors leading out to the rear garden. This room also has a picture rail and a feature fireplace housing an electric fire.


Kitchen
The spacious family kitchen enjoys the same light and airy westerly outlook and has a door leading to the garden.

The kitchen is tastefully appointed and provides a pleasant open-plan space ideal for contemporary family living and entertaining.

The kitchen area is laid to Karndean flooring and has quality bespoke fitments from Kitchen Gallery including cream-coloured wall and base units complemented by work surfaces incorporating an inset Belfast sink and accompanying antique-style tap.

There is also an integrated dishwasher and Rangemaster oven included in the sale.


Utility area
There is a useful utility area, which is open plan from the kitchen and has wall and base units, a Belfast sink, space and plumbing for appliances in addition to a wall-mounted Ideal combination boiler.

A door from the utility leads to a useful pantry featuring space for a fridge freezer and a door accessing the garage.


Annexe
This wonderful self-contained annexe has a separate front door and an entrance hall, the latter is tastefully decorated and features wall lights, a Velux window, tiled flooring, useful built-in bookshelves and a cloaks cupboard.

The shower room and kitchen are accessed from the hallway, with the former having a Velux skylight, mosaic-tiled shower cubicle and low-level WC/washbasin combo.

There is a well-appointed kitchen fitted with bespoke units by Kitchen Gallery and also featuring a large skylight, tiled flooring, a twin circular sink/dryer with antique style tap, a built-in dresser, an oven and hob, space for a fridge and dishwasher or a washing machine.

A door from the kitchen leads nicely onto the rear of the annexe, which is currently used as a combined living space and bedroom. This spacious and light room is newly redecorated and enjoys a sunny west-facing aspect overlooking the rear garden, with French doors leading outside.


First floor
The first floor of the main residence is extremely spacious, comprising four bedrooms and a family bathroom.


Bedroom one
Bedroom one is a large double room featuring nice views of the nearby countryside and benefiting from accompanying ensuite facilities.

The ensuite bathroom is stylish and features a free-standing roll-top bathtub with claw feet, quality Karndean flooring, a chrome towel radiator and a solid wooden washstand with twin washbasin.


Bedrooms two, three and four
The second bedroom is a similarly large double room featuring mirror-fronted fitted wardrobes to one wall and lots of natural light flooding in from the west-facing window, which also provides great views of the local countryside.

Bedroom three is a good-sized double room benefiting from fitted mirror-fronted wardrobes, whilst bedroom four is a light and airy single room, with two windows to the front.


Family bathroom
The family bathroom is well-presented and includes Travertine tiled walls, a chrome towel radiator and fitted furniture incorporating storage, a washbasin and a low-level WC.


Garden
An extensive family home such as this deserves quality outside space and the rear garden here does not fail to deliver, being substantial in size, very private and boasting a sunny west-facing orientation. This delightful garden is extremely mature and packed with an array of plants and trees, including acer, laburnum, magnolia, apple trees and ornamental cherry to name but a few.

The garden has been nicely designed too and has a raised patio servicing the main house and the annexe, with steps from here leading to a large lawn interspersed by wildflower beds to encourage nature to flourish. There is a greenhouse included in the sale in addition to a shed tucked away in one corner and there is gated access to one side of the property.

Reservation Fee - refundable on exchange

A reservation fee, refundable on exchange, will be payable by the Buyer to Andrew Grant Sales Limited prior to issuing the Memorandum of Sale and marking the property as Sold Subject to Contract. This fee will be reimbursed upon Exchange of contracts.

In the instance the Seller withdraws from the sale the fee will be returned to the Buyer. The fee will be retained by Andrew Grant Sales Ltd to cover costs in the event the Buyer withdraws from the purchase or doesn't Exchange within 6 months of the fee being received other than as a result of:

1. Any structural or material issues arising from any survey that has not previously been disclosed
2. A defect in the seller’s legal title
3. The local searches reveal any matter that has a material adverse effect on the market value of the property that were previously undeclared or unknown

The reservation fee levels are as follows:
an agreed offer under £500,000 will be £750 inclusive of vat
an agreed offer between £500,000 and £1,000,000 will be £2,000 inclusive of vat
all agreed offers over £1,000,000 will be £3,000 inclusive of vat

The reservation fee is payable upon acceptance of an offer which itself is subject to an assessment of ability to proceed. Any renegotiation of an accepted price after the issue of the Sales Memorandum for any reason not covered in points 1 to 3 above will lead to the reservation fee being retained. A further fee will be payable on any subsequent reduced offer accepted by the vendor. This will be returnable subject to the conditions that prevail for all reservation fees.
